Softmatter is the wearable technology company of MAS with a portfolio of patented technologies. By enabling the intersection between textiles and electronics we create products that enhance experiences, function, and everyday interactions. By combining years of expertise with stellar integration techniques, we bring ideas to life by crafting solutions that create new digital and functional experiences.

As a Production Engineer – New Product Integration, you will be required to:

  • Lead New Product Introduction (NPI) activities from prototype to mass production readiness by providing DFM recommendations, evaluating designs for manufacturability, assembly efficiency, quality and cost optimization, and coordinating cross-functional teams to drive successful product industrialization. 

  • Drive product transfer and contract manufacturing activities, ensuring successful transition to manufacturing partners.

  • Develop and implement robust manufacturing processes for new products by planning and executing process qualification and validation activities, validating production equipment and machinery during NPI stages, and conducting process capability studies to establish effective process controls.

  • Define and implement quality gates, inspection methods, testing procedures, acceptance criteria, and control plans while ensuring compliance with customer, regulatory, and company quality requirements, and supporting root cause analysis and corrective actions for quality issues.

  • Develop work instructions, SOPs, and visual aids; train operators, supervisors, and technicians on approved manufacturing processes; conduct production handover activities to ensure operational readiness; and monitor initial production runs while providing technical support to production teams.

  • Conduct regular process audits to ensure compliance with established standards, identify improvement opportunities and eliminate waste, lead continuous improvement initiatives using Lean Manufacturing and Six Sigma methodologies, and validate process changes to ensure sustained process performance.

  • Identify opportunities to reduce manufacturing costs and improve yield by optimizing production processes, material utilization, labour and machine efficiency, supporting value engineering and cost-down initiatives, and analyzing manufacturing data to drive productivity improvements.

  • Initiate and support the development of manufacturing tools, fixtures, jigs, and automation solutions, collaborate with suppliers and internal teams on tooling qualification and implementation, evaluate automation opportunities to enhance productivity, quality, and safety, and support the commissioning and validation of new manufacturing equipment.

  • Maintain manufacturing process documentation, including SOPs, PFMEA, Control Plans, and Work Instructions, ensure compliance with ISO, customer, and industry standards, and support internal and external audits as required.

     

The ideal candidate should have:

  • A Bachelor’s degree in Electronics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Applied Sciences, or a related discipline.

  • 3–7 years of experience in electronics product development, manufacturing engineering, New Product Introduction (NPI), product industrialization, or a related field.

  • Experience working with contract manufacturers and product transfer projects, with hands-on experience in process validation, quality systems, and production support activities.

  • Strong knowledge of Design for Manufacturing (DFM), Design for Assembly (DFA), process validation, equipment qualification, PFMEA, Control Plans, Process Flow Diagrams, Root Cause Analysis, Statistical Process Control (SPC), and process capability analysis.  

  • Proficient in Lean Manufacturing and continuous improvement methodologies, tooling, fixture and jig development, automation solutions, manufacturing documentation, and technical training.

  • Knowledge of ISO 9001, ISO 13485, or equivalent quality management systems, with Six Sigma Green Belt certification considered an advantage. Strong project management and cross-functional leadership experience, with excellent analytical and problem-solving skills.

  • Ability to mentor junior engineers and contribute to technical training and knowledge-sharing initiatives.

MAS is an innovation driven company founded on a perfect blend of daring and visionary thinking. Focusing on fashion and lifestyle, we are one of Asia’s largest manufacturers of intimate apparel, sportswear, performance wear and swimwear and provide IT solutions to the apparel and footwear industry worldwide. MAS nurtures and drives a culture of excellence where over 114,000 global associates activate their full potential.
